Auburn basketball players honored with SPSL North 4A all-league selections | Girls Basketball

The Auburn Riverside girls basketball team dominated this week’s South Puget Sound League North 4A all-league rosters, with five Raven players and head coach Terry Johnson all garnering honors.

University of Washington-bound senior Mercedes Wetmore was selected as the SPSL North 4A’s Co-player of the Year, sharing the honor with Kentwood’s Kylie Huerta.

This season Wetmore’s team-high 17.2 points per game has helped the No. 1 ranked Raven girls compile a perfect 16-0 league record, 23-0 overall. The team captured the SPSL North 4A title and currently has their sights set on repeating as district champions. Wetmore was also selected to the first team all-league squad.

Junior Kat Cooper was also honored with a first-team selection. So far this season Cooper is averaging 14.5 points per game.

Kara Jenkins, Brooklyn Hinkens and Taylor Wofford earned honorable mentions.

First year head coach Johnson was also honored with the Coach of the Year award.

The Ravens will play Federal Way (13-3, 21-4) at 7 p.m. Wednesday at the Showare Center in Kent. The winner will advance to the WCD II 4A title game against either Kentwood or Bellarmine at the Showare this Friday.

ALSO: Auburn senior Heather Restrepo was selected to the SPSL North 4A second-team. Restrepo is averaging 14.2 points per game. Trojan sophomore Isia Johnson was picked as an honorable mention.
